I believe the difference between Ritalin and Concerta is Concerta has a time release mechanism, so you take one in 12 hours and it releases slowly, which mitigates the speedy feeling you'd get from taking straight ritalin. They both contain the same active ingredient, Methylphenidate, as someone mentioned before.
Thus, just like oxycontin, a "breaking" of the time release mechanism before ingestion has a vastly different effect.
